News From Payhembury Provisions – March 2017

1 March 2017 By Sue

miscThis month we are very happy to say that we have been able to make two substantial donations:

Firstly, we were invited by the Parish Council to make a contribution towards the cost of a new gate for the playing field which we hope will make life easier for mums and carers struggling with toddlers and buggies.

Secondly, we are delighted to help with the cost of a new mower for the Tale Millers cricket club, how’s that?!

I’m sure everyone will realise that we are only able to make donations to enhance our village because, misc2unlike most other community shops, apart from a couple of hours of accountancy help a month to oversee our book-keeping, we don’t pay a salary to anyone. We are always very pleased to welcome new volunteers (especially cricket club members!) and for those who don’t want to get behind the till or who just want to pop in from time to time when it suits them, there are plenty of jobs which you could help us with. Please get in touch with Anne Baxter 841345 or leave a message for her at the shop.

miscWe’re always on the look out for local products and hope to introduce some new lines this month, so please keep an eye on our shelves for these as well as special gifts and flowers for Mothering Sunday.

Prices seem to be increasing in all the supermarkets at the moment but at misc3Payhembury Provisions we always try to give you great value for money; come in and have a look at our price comparison chart and you’ll see how well we’re doing.
